About
"Long Island's location and terrain gave it a significant role in defending the United States for over two hundred years. Forming the eastern shore of New York's harbor, Long Island provided sites for seaward defense, while its flat, grassy plain was an ideal location for airfields. Many fortifications, encampments, and defense factories were built on Long Island ... [This book] traces this unique history, beginning with the Battle of Long Island in 1776 and continuing through the Cold War into the 1980s"--Page 4 of cover.
